Safeguarding Fundamental Rights

Undertaking lawful arrest procedures necessitates meticulous adherence to a comprehensive legal checklist. This protocol strives to guarantee that individuals' constitutional rights are respected, thereby preventing the risk of unlawful detentions and subsequent legal challenges. A thorough checklist typically includes key aspects such as proper confirmation of the suspect, clarification of the grounds for arrest, provision of Miranda warnings, and filing of the entire procedure. By utilizing these safeguards, law enforcement agencies can confirm that arrests are conducted in a manner consistent with due process.

Failure to comply with these essential legal requirements can have severe consequences for both the arresting officers and the accused.

Technological Innovations Revolutionizing Wildlife Conservation and Tracking

In the realm of wildlife conservation, advanced AI tools are rapidly shaping the landscape. These intelligent systems offer unprecedented capabilities for monitoring animal populations, identifying threats, and optimizing conservation efforts. Through sophisticated algorithms and machine learning, AI can analyze vast amounts of evidence gathered from various sources, such as camera traps, drones, and satellite imagery. This allows for real-time insights into animal movements, habitat usage, and population trends.

Moreover, AI-powered tools can assist in locating poaching activities, tracking illegal wildlife trade, and predicting potential threats to endangered species. By providing valuable information to conservationists, AI empowers them to make informed decisions that protect vulnerable ecosystems and biodiversity.
